JUST IN: FG Govt Declares Oct 1 Public Holiday, See What To Expect
The Federal Government has declared Wednesday, October 1, 2025, a public holiday in celebration of Nigeria’s 65th Independence Anniversary.
In a statement signed by the ministry’s Permanent Secretary, Dr. Magdalene Ajani, the Minister, Dr. Tunji-Ojo, urged Nigerians to uphold the values of patriotism, unity, and resilience that have kept the nation together since 1960.
He encouraged citizens to remain committed to President Bola Tinubu’s Renewed Hope Agenda, which focuses on national rebirth, economic transformation, and shared prosperity.
The Minister expressed optimism that with collective effort, Nigeria will continue to thrive in peace, progress, and development.
He also wished all Nigerians a joyful and memorable Independence Day celebration.
